Transaction dd489426c7e99c02ca3099f9071e4bbcf57ae345c046d87a37a395912e2cb1a3
1 Input
1 Output
-
dd489426c7e99c02ca3099f9071e4bbcf57ae345c046d87a37a395912e2cb1a3:0
- value
- 168542
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d4795352dce8787d776653bfa52eefbe4621f1e
- address
- bc1qe4re2dfde6rc04mkv5al55hwl0jxy8c7d55s3r